“Designing and attaching a 2-story structure to an 1850’s log house is probably  the sort of challenge from which  many contractors would back away.  But, for Jim Irvine, it was a project that was enthusiastically embraced and one in which his attention to detail , expert knowledge,  and decades of experience lead to a beautiful finished product and happy clients!  Jim’s daily visits to the construction site ensured that everything was ALWAYS under control.

Jim listened to our vision and incorporated those ideas, along with practical ones we hadn’t considered, to make our  30+ year dream come true.  He understood our desire to marry the old with the new and has a good working relationship with local, Mennonite craftsmen who were employed to custom-make trim and doors that would match those items in the original log house.                 

The sub-contractors were all well experienced in their trades and most had been working on Jim’s projects  for 10 years or more.  Many of the sub-contractor’s businesses were local to the Frederick County and Thurmont area.  The workers were always conscientious, friendly, polite and considerate of us and of each other. We truly missed the daily rapport we had with these individuals as their contribution to the process was completed and they moved on to their next job. We highly recommend Jim Irvine for any renovations or home addition project!”

Location: Frederick County, Maryland
Project: Log Home Addition
